This home is located in the riverfront town of Welaka, Florida and is on the east bank of the St. Johns River (bass fishing capital) about halfway between Palatka and Deland. It is not on the main highway, so you have to work a bit to find it. The Florida back roads leading into Welaka are beautiful, many of them canopied with old oak trees showing grey beards of hanging Spanish Moss. Welaka doesn't get much traffic, and you will get a good feeling of old Florida tranquility.
